The 4D Technology Market has emerged as a transformative sector in today’s technology-driven world. By integrating 3D visualization with time-based simulations, 4D technology provides dynamic insights into processes, products, and environments. This capability is crucial for design optimization, predictive maintenance, and virtual testing, offering industries a competitive edge.The growing demand for smart manufacturing, Industry 4.0, and real-time data analytics is driving the adoption of 4D technologies. Companies are leveraging these solutions to simulate workflows, monitor complex systems, and anticipate potential disruptions before they occur. Additionally, sectors like healthcare are using 4D imaging for surgical planning, diagnostics, and patient care, while the entertainment and gaming industries capitalize on immersive experiences to engage audiences.
Challenges such as high deployment costs and integration complexities are balanced by opportunities in emerging markets and technological advancements in sensors, computing power, and visualization software.
